Ingredients
8 portion(s)
You Need:
- 900g Blade or Chuck steak, (or topside) chopped into 3-4 cubes
- 1 brown onion
- 1 clove garlic
- 20g oil or butter
- 1/2 tsp Curry Power (optional)
- 3 tsp smoked paprika
- 1 tbsp soy sauce
- 400g can chopped tomatos
- 120g red wine
- 1 pkt french oinion soup mix
- 2-3 sticks celery chopped
- 2 Carrots chopped
- 1 large potato
- 1/2 capsicum red chopped
- 70g almonds, (blanched)
- Salt & pepper to taste
Optional
- pineapple pieces

Recipe's preparation
1. Place onion & garlic into TM bowl and chop 3 secs, speed 7.
2. Add paprika and curry powder (if using), with oil or butter and saute 5mins, varoma speed 1 - mc off.
3. Add meat and soy sauce cook 5mins, varoma, "Counter-clockwise operation" reverse, sp 1 - basket or MC on top
4. Stir meat and make sure its not stuck under the blades, add red wine, tomatos, french onion soup mix, cook 30 mins, 100deg, "Counter-clockwise operation" reverse, speed 1 - basket on top
5. Add carrot, celery, potato (if using) and continue cooking 15mins, 100deg, "Counter-clockwise operation" reverse, sp 1 - basket on top. Reduce cooking speed to .05, "Counter-clockwise operation" reverse, and continue cooking for another 15-20mins.
6. Place almonds in a bowl with boiling water & cover with cling wrap. Once skins have softened break an end open and almonds should 'pop' out between your fingers. set aside.
7. Once meat is tender and a gravy has formed stir through salt & pepper, chopped capsicum blanched almonds, pineapple pieces (if using) - you could put all into your thermomserver and stir. Serve with rice or mashed potato and vegies!
8. Dishes like this get better after a day or so!

Tip
Some pineapple pieces added at the end are also nice through this dish.
Could use the butterfly when sauteing the meat to keep it separated.
